Understanding Chiropractic Care
Chiropractic care is a non-invasive, hands-on healthcare discipline that centers around the spine and its relationship to the nervous system. A chiropractor uses controlled adjustments to restore spinal alignment, relieve pressure on nerves, and encourage the body’s natural healing processes.
When your spine is properly aligned, the nervous system can transmit signals efficiently throughout the body. This helps muscles, joints, and tissues work in harmony, a foundation for good posture and fluid movement. Beyond spinal adjustments, chiropractors often include stretching, strengthening, and ergonomic advice to promote lasting mobility improvements.

How Chiropractic Improves Posture
Poor posture is often caused by prolonged sitting, weak core muscles, and spinal misalignment. Over time, these factors pull the body out of its natural alignment. Chiropractic adjustments target these misalignments, or “subluxations,” helping the spine return to its correct position.
Through regular chiropractic sessions, the muscles and joints supporting the spine are retrained to maintain healthy alignment. Chiropractors also teach posture correction exercises and ergonomic habits that strengthen the core and back muscles. As alignment improves, pain and tension decrease, allowing you to stand taller, move more easily, and breathe better.

How Chiropractic Enhances Mobility
Mobility refers to your ability to move freely without stiffness or pain. When spinal joints are restricted, mobility naturally declines. Chiropractic adjustments restore proper motion to these joints, helping improve flexibility and range of movement.
By reducing inflammation, releasing muscle tension, and restoring spinal balance, chiropractic care allows the body to move the way it was designed to. Many patients report that after consistent chiropractic treatments, everyday activities, like bending, turning, or lifting, become easier and more comfortable.
Regular chiropractic maintenance also helps prevent future injuries. By maintaining proper alignment, the joints, muscles, and connective tissues stay flexible, reducing the risk of strains or sprains during physical activity.

Building Healthy Habits with Chiropractic Support
For long-term results, chiropractic care is most effective when combined with lifestyle improvements. Chiropractors often recommend exercises, stretching routines, and ergonomic modifications tailored to each patient’s needs. Simple changes, like adjusting desk height, using lumbar support, and taking movement breaks, reinforce spinal alignment between visits.
Commitment to these habits can make posture correction permanent and keep mobility high. The goal isn’t just temporary relief; it’s sustainable wellness through balance, strength, and awareness of body mechanics.

FAQs
1. How often should I visit a chiropractor for posture improvement?
Frequency depends on your condition. Many patients begin with weekly visits, then shift to maintenance care every few weeks once alignment stabilizes.
2. Can chiropractic treatment help with age-related stiffness?
Yes. Chiropractic adjustments improve joint mobility, flexibility, and circulation, which helps reduce stiffness common in older adults.
3. Is chiropractic care safe for everyone?
When performed by a licensed chiropractor, it’s considered very safe for most people. Chiropractors customize treatments based on age, health, and mobility levels.
4. How soon can I expect results from chiropractic sessions?
Some patients notice relief after their first visit, while others require several sessions for lasting improvement, depending on the severity of misalignment.
